When it comes to David Copperfield everything seems to be a continuous April Fool. But what we are going to tell you about him, looks pretty real. The famous magician is called to perform in Michael Jackson’s 50 years old tour in London on July 8.

So the man who made the Statue of Liberty disappear will help King of Pop to have a really special O2 Show with his mindblowing magic.

The plans that includes David Copperfield already started when he and Michael met at the magician’s Californian HQ so according to some sources the magic performance will have high wire routines and a levitation trick. We don’t know yet why, but more than 100 mirrors and a lot of dry ice were ordered.

So we are curious how the two of them will put music and magic all together.
